When U.S. Secretary of State Hillary Clinton and Treasury Secretary Timothy Geithner met last week with their Chinese counterparts in Washington, D.C., they pledged closer cooperation in dealing with a host of pressing economic issues, not the least of which are protectionist barriers to global trade. Yet, while policy makers in both countries – and other global leaders – champion principles of free and balanced trade, their respective populations seem to have mixed views on the topic.
